Output e633c119f7840e39cfdbc88e86a9d254810457254df875005ee2d366142ad826:0

value
4379703
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c654d917e0258c6ea2c7692d975116be4524df7 OP_EQUALVERIFY OP_CHECKSIG
address
17xwiEdfZXvRKHUWedsMFhkJKsidtK5ooT
transaction
e633c119f7840e39cfdbc88e86a9d254810457254df875005ee2d366142ad826
confirmations
435982
spent
true